Second-time founder Jacob Banks breaks down how Sophiie AI is growing at 30% month-on-month in one of the most crowded AI markets. Drawing on lessons from scaling Service.com.au into a leading service marketplace, he explains how those experiences shaped Sophiie’s go-to-market strategy, pricing, and team structure.
In this episode, Jacob goes deep on the GTM mechanics driving Sophiie’s growth — including high-velocity content testing, vertical selection, sales execution, and the leadership decisions behind building a lean, high-performing team. He also shares what investors looked for in Sophiie’s oversubscribed raise and how the company is scaling without losing focus.
